Ideal for business & leisure travellers, the Harrington Hall is located just a few minutes walk from the Gloucester Road Underground station which offers a direct link to Heathrow Airport. The same station also enables very fast direct access to the West End Districts of Leicester Square and also Covent Garden. Within a one mile radius of the hotel there are many of London's attractions including Harrods, Olympia, Earls Court Exhibtion Centre, Kensington High Street, The Royal Albert Hall, Hyde Park, Knightsbridge and many major museums.
This is categorised as a 4 star deluxe hotel and comprises 200 air-conditioned bedrooms. Behind the original period facade the hotel offers a modern but elegant standard of accommodation in a beautifully designed classical setting. The Lounge Bar combines warmth and sophistication with comfortable traditional furnishings. The bar in exotic Burr Vavona and the marble fireplace provide classical focal points. The Restaurant has a mixture of classical decoration and dramatic colours which creates the perfect setting for the appreciation of fine cuisine. A tempting selection of dishes is available from the choice of buffet or a la carte menu.
The bedrooms are very tastefully furnished to high international standards and for those requiring a little extra comfort there are suites available capable of accommodating up to 3 persons. All bedrooms contain have an extensive array of facilities such as satellite and interactive television, mini-bar, hair dryer, trouser press, state of the art message system which even includes your own telephone number. General amenities include 24 hour room service, same day laundry and dry cleaning. A number of floors are dedicated non smoking. For the business traveller, there is a business centre which provides an extensive range of secretarial services including word processing, photocopying, telex and fax.
Guests can choose to tone up in the small private fitness centre which has a multi-gym, sauna and showers.
This hotel deserves the 4 star status. The public areas are comfortable and of a high standard. The staff are extremely customer orientated. The standard rooms are well appointed and the beds are some of the most comfortable we have tried. There was a couple of little problems during our stay, on arrival they told us they had not received our booking fax yet the following morning they had managed to locate it. We booked a 9 am alarm call which never happened but to be fair, 40 minutes late they sent the Concierge up to the room to wake us. The breakfast is waiter served and of a high quality with never ending coffee refills without having to chase for attention. We parked just 30 yards away in a secure pay car park which is a great bonus. Having always stayed at the Rembrandt and been very happy with it, we would now seriously consider switching to Harrington Hall. This hotel is one we shall use again without question.
